2009 FEDERAL POVERTY LEVEL GUIDELINES
Each year, updated Federal Poverty Level (FPL) guidelines are published in the Federal Register in January/February, but aren't adopted by MassHealth until several months later. This year, MassHealth will begin using these new income levels on March 1st. So as of March 1st, these are the figures that MassHealth will be using to determine eligibility for MassHealth, Commonwealth Care, and Health Safety Net, and also to calculate premium amounts for MassHealth and Commonwealth Care patients. Prescription Advantage will use the 2008 FPLs until July 1, 2009. These figures are also used for eligibility for other public benefits including SNAP (formerly Food Stamps), TAFDC, and Fuel Assistance (Prescription Advantage will use new FPLs starting April 1).
